Preparation method of carbon-ceramic brake disc
The invention provides a preparation method of a carbon-ceramic brake material. The method comprises the following steps: putting a low-density carbon/carbon green body into silicon powder impregnation slurry, drying after impregnation is completed, then putting the silicon powder impregnated carbon/carbon green body into a silicification treatment furnace, and carrying out in-situ melting chemical reaction on silicon powder in the carbon green body and deposited carbon on the surface of the green body at high temperature to form a SiC ceramic phase. According to the method, a tool crucible does not need to be used in the melting siliconizing process, and the charging space and the siliconizing raw materials are saved; and the process is simple, the implementation is convenient, the siliconizing amount is easy to control and adjust, and the formed ceramic is good in phase dispersivity and uniformity, low in residual silicon content and stable in performance.
